Plot

Eugene continues his conversations with Stephanie over the radio. He discovers that she also saw the falling satellite and determines she must be relatively nearby. Eugene offers to allow her to select a time and place for them to meet, and she says she will discuss it with the others. Meanwhile at the Hilltop,

Ratings

"Morning Star" received 2.93 million viewers, the lowest rating in the show's history to date.
